    What's the scoop on Fitzy's previous stoppage loss, to Janis Cernauskis of Latvia?

    It was on the Dunne vs. Cordoba undercard, so even if RTE didn't televise it a good many of the posters on here probably have recollection of seeing it live in the flesh as I'm sure I've seen plenty claim to have been there on the night.

    Can anyone dish on the circumstances? Decent stoppage? Cuts or injury to Fitzgerald?

    Just wondering if Spike is the first to ever knock him out clean, like.

    Given the losing record of Cernauskis, even though all his victories came by KO or TKO, just going by his complete lack of success other than Fitzgerald one can't help wondering if that was a bit flukey, seeing as how Fitzgerald went ten comfortably with Lee & HNN. :think

    Knocked out flat on his back, clean KO after a big hook, don't recall if it was right or left. All the usual excuses, lack of focus, no serious training, distractions elsewhere, were wheeled out. Cernauskis did the same to another decent Irish fighter in Karl Brabazon.
